Verheugen wants to slash administrative costs by 25%, which according to recent assessment stood at €600 billion a year

Brussels, 10/10/2006 (Agence Europe) - In an interview to the Financial Times Deutschland on Tuesday, the Commissioner for Industry and Enterprise, Günter Verhuegen, explained that European companies face bureaucratic costs of €600 billion a year. He believes that it would be possible to reduce this amount by at least 25%.
